U.S. Army Cpl. Jeffrey MacDonald, a native of Boston, Mass., a Solider assigned to the 1-24 Infantry Charlie (Centurion Company), from Fort Wainwright, AK, loads a Stryker armored unit with .50 cal. ammunition during early-morning, live-fire training at Rodriguez Live Fire Range. Centurion Company is taking part in Exercise Key Resolve/Foal Eagle 2008, an annual combined/joint exercise involving forces from both the U.S. and Republic of Korea (ROK). This exercise provides training to further enhance interoperability and combat readiness, while also demonstrating both countriesÕ commitment to the ROK/US alliance.
